The stairs lead to a rough-hewn, winding passage. It is wide enough for two two walk abreast comfortably, and the roof is only occasionally low enough to need to duck. In places it is interrupted by more short flights of steps, up or down.

[sblock=Dungeoneering 12]
Judging by gouges in the walls, the passage twists and changes level so much because it was following a seam of ore. The stairs must have been added later - miners wouldn't take the time to add such conveniences, they would just leave the floor sloping.
[/sblock]

Eventually you reach a side passage. A flight of steps leads downwards to your left, and you can hear the sound of rushing water from below. The passage also continues straight ahead into darkness.

Sure enough, the passage is blocked by water - after a short flight of steps downwards, it levels out into a tunnel that ends abruptly at a precipice. A river (almost certainly the same one Karma disappeared into) rushes past dozens of feet below.

An arm's length in front of the tunnel mouth, water tumbles from an unseen opening overhead and showers into the river below. Your light is reflected back in myriad glitters from the droplets of water, but strangely - the outermost reflections are cool silver, but those towards the center have a red-orange glow that makes the waterfall look like it has a core of fire.
